This is a really pretty 1957 Ladies Sheffield Sterling Silver Handled Letter Opener.
The handle is sterling silver and the blade a mirror finish stainless steel.
Makers Mark: Harrison Brothers
The crown: indicates Sheffield
Lion indicates sterling .925
The letter, a fancy P, is indicating 1957
If you flip it over, it seems to have a redundant crown and lion markings.
